区块链游戏切换怎么弄的,从零开始到高级操作全解析区块链游戏切换怎么弄的
本文目录导读:
随着区块链技术的快速发展,区块链游戏逐渐成为娱乐、投资和技术创新的重要领域,对于许多刚接触区块链游戏的玩家来说,如何切换区块链游戏,尤其是如何在不同的区块链网络之间无缝切换,可能是一个让人困惑的问题,本文将从零开始,详细解析区块链游戏切换的整个流程,帮助你轻松掌握这一技术。
区块链游戏切换的必要性
在区块链游戏领域,不同的区块链网络(如以太坊、Solana、BSC等)提供了不同的游戏体验,每种区块链网络都有其独特的优势,比如以太坊的高安全性、Solana的低交易费用、BSC的高吞吐量等,玩家可能需要在不同的区块链网络之间切换,以享受更优的游戏体验。
区块链游戏切换并非易事,由于区块链是分布式账本,不同区块链之间没有直接的交互机制,玩家需要借助一些技术手段,如跨链桥接(Cross-Chain)技术,才能在不同区块链之间进行游戏切换。
区块链游戏切换的准备工作
在进行区块链游戏切换之前,玩家需要做好充分的准备工作,以确保切换过程顺利进行,以下是准备工作的主要内容:
确认目标区块链网络
在切换之前,玩家需要明确自己希望切换到哪个区块链网络,不同的区块链网络有不同的游戏特性、社区支持和市场地位,因此选择适合自己的区块链网络非常重要。
准备测试环境
为了确保切换操作的顺利进行,玩家需要在本地或测试环境中进行充分的准备工作,这包括:
- 安装并配置目标区块链网络的开发环境。
- 测试切换工具和跨链桥接技术的稳定性。
准备必要的工具和脚本
为了实现跨链切换,玩家需要准备一些必要的工具和脚本,这些工具和脚本可能包括:
- 跨链桥接工具(如Zerox、Zerox-RS、 relayer 等)。
- 各种编程语言的脚本(如Solidity、Python、JavaScript 等)。
- 相关的 API 和接口文档。
确保网络连接稳定
由于跨链切换需要通过网络进行通信,因此确保网络连接的稳定性和带宽非常重要,尤其是在高交易量的网络中,网络波动可能导致切换失败。
学习相关技术文档
为了更好地理解跨链切换的技术原理和操作流程,玩家需要仔细阅读相关技术文档,这包括:
- 跨链技术的官方文档。
- 各种跨链工具的使用说明。
- 相关社区的讨论和教程。
区块链游戏切换的步骤
准备跨链工具
跨链切换的核心是使用跨链工具(如Zerox、Zerox-RS、 relayer 等)来实现不同区块链之间的交互,以下是选择跨链工具的注意事项:
- Zerox:Zerox 是一个广泛使用的跨链工具,支持多种区块链之间的交互,它通过创建一个中间的区块链(Zerox Chain)来实现跨链通信。
- Zerox-RS:Zerox-RS 是 Zerox 的增强版,支持更复杂的跨链交互,适合高并发场景。
- Relayer:Relayer 是一个专注于高性能跨链工具,支持多种区块链之间的交互。
准备跨链脚本
跨链脚本是实现跨链切换的核心代码,脚本通常用于:
- 创建跨链通道。
- 发送跨链请求。
- 接收跨链响应。
以下是编写跨链脚本的注意事项:
- 使用 Solidity 或其他脚本语言编写。
- 确保脚本兼容目标区块链的协议。
- 测试脚本的稳定性。
进行跨链切换
跨链切换的具体步骤如下:
a. 初始化跨链通道
在跨链工具中,首先需要初始化跨链通道,这包括:
- 创建跨链通道请求。
- 获取通道响应。
- 处理通道响应。
b. 发送跨链请求
在跨链通道初始化后,玩家可以发送跨链请求,这包括:
- 编写跨链请求的 Solidity 脚本。
- 发送请求到目标区块链。
- 接收并处理响应。
c. 接收跨链响应
跨链请求发送后,目标区块链会返回响应,玩家需要接收并处理这些响应,以完成跨链切换。
测试和优化
跨链切换完成后,需要对整个过程进行测试和优化,这包括:
- 测试跨链工具的稳定性。
- 测试跨链脚本的性能。
- 优化跨链请求的效率。
区块链游戏切换的注意事项
在进行区块链游戏切换时,玩家需要注意以下几点:
确保网络连接稳定
由于跨链切换需要通过网络进行通信,因此确保网络连接的稳定性和带宽非常重要,尤其是在高交易量的网络中,网络波动可能导致切换失败。
确保跨链工具的可用性
跨链工具的可用性直接影响跨链切换的成功率,玩家需要确保跨链工具在切换期间是可用的。
确保跨链脚本的安全性
跨链脚本的安全性是跨链切换成功的关键,玩家需要确保脚本的安全性,避免因脚本漏洞导致的跨链失败。
确保跨链请求的响应时间
由于跨链请求可能需要较长时间才能收到响应,因此玩家需要确保跨链请求的响应时间在可接受范围内。
确保跨链请求的费用
由于跨链请求可能需要支付费用(如以太坊交易费用),因此玩家需要确保跨链请求的费用在预算范围内。
区块链游戏切换的高级操作
对于有经验的玩家来说,跨链切换还可以进行一些高级操作,以进一步优化切换过程,以下是高级操作的介绍:
同步切换
同步切换是指在多个区块链之间同时进行切换,这需要跨链工具的支持,并且需要确保多个跨链通道的稳定性。
异步切换
异步切换是指在切换完成后,玩家可以继续在目标区块链上进行游戏,这需要跨链工具的支持,并且需要确保跨链通道的稳定性。
跨链桥接
跨链桥接是指在多个区块链之间建立一个中间桥梁,以实现更高效的跨链切换,这需要跨链工具的支持,并且需要确保桥梁的稳定性。
跨链优化
跨链优化是指优化跨链脚本和跨链工具,以提高切换的效率和稳定性,这需要跨链工具的支持,并且需要具备一定的编程和优化能力。
区块链游戏切换是一个复杂但有趣的技术过程,通过本文的详细解析,你可以更好地理解跨链切换的原理和操作流程,通过准备充分的工具和脚本,并注意网络连接和脚本安全,你可以更高效地进行跨链切换,希望本文能帮助你掌握区块链游戏切换的技巧,让你在区块链游戏中更加得心应手。
区块链游戏切换怎么弄的,从零开始到高级操作全解析区块链游戏切换怎么弄的,
发表评论